Comprehending Car Keys
Before diving into the replacement process, it is vital to comprehend the various types of car keys readily available. Here's a short introduction:
Type of Car KeyDescriptionConventional KeyA standard metal key that mechanically unlocks and starts the vehicle.Transponder KeyA key with a chip that interacts with the car's ignition system for added security.Key FobA remote device that allows keyless entry and might consist of functions to start the vehicle from a range.Smart KeyA distance key that allows the chauffeur to unlock and start the car without physically utilizing the key.Valet KeyA restricted key that permits limited access to the vehicle, primarily for valet services.
Understanding the kind of key you have is crucial in determining the process of getting a replacement.
Actions to Get a Replacement Car Key
If you find yourself in requirement of a replacement car key, follow these steps to navigate the process efficiently:
1. Recognize the Type of KeyIdentify whether you have a standard key, transponder key, key fob, or wise key. This information will influence the replacement procedure.2. Check Your Insurance PolicyReview your auto insurance plan to see if it covers key replacement. Some policies offer this benefit, which could save you time and money.3. Contact Your Car DealershipReach out to your car's dealer, particularly for newer lorries that make use of advanced key innovation.Be prepared to offer your vehicle recognition number (VIN), evidence of ownership, and possibly your vehicle registration.4. Go to a LocksmithConsider going to an expert locksmith who has experience with automotive keys.Numerous locksmith professionals can develop and program transponder keys and key fobs at a lower expense than dealerships.5. Use Online ServicesSome services focus on automotive key replacement and may use online assistance.Beware and guarantee that you select a reputable provider.6. Expense ConsiderationsComprehend the potential costs associated with getting a replacement key. Below is a general cost price quote based upon key type:Key TypeApproximated Cost RangeConventional Key₤ 2 - ₤ 5Transponder Key₤ 50 - ₤ 200Key Fob₤ 100 - ₤ 600Smart Key₤ 200 - ₤ 500Often Asked Questions (FAQs)1. For how long does it require to get a replacement key?The time to obtain a replacement key differs depending upon the service provider. Car dealerships might take a few days, while locksmiths can frequently supply a key the same day.2. Can I replace a key myself?While it is possible to purchase a blank key online and cut it yourself, setting electronic keys normally requires specialized equipment.3. What should I do if my key is lost or stolen?If your key is lost or taken, it is sensible to reprogram your locks to prevent unapproved access to your vehicle.4. Are all car keys programmable?Not all car keys can be programmed. Traditional mechanical keys are cut but do not need programs, while transponder keys and smart keys do.5.
